ZIP Code Tabulation Areas (ZCTAs) are Census approximations of USPS ZIP codes. Boundaries may differ slightly from postal delivery areas, and estimates for less-populated ZCTAs carry higher margins of error.

Data: U.S. Census Bureau, 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023 (released December 2024).

Quick Facts — 67575

What is the median household income in 67575?
The median household income in 67575 is $69,583 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
What is the poverty rate in 67575?
The poverty rate in 67575 is 5.1%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the median home value in 67575?
$89,000 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the average rent in 67575?
The median gross rent in 67575 is $903 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What percentage of 67575 residents have a college degree?
18.4% of adults in 67575 h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
